Condensing Boilers For Great Conservation Of Energy

The condensing boilers are known to be the most effective boilers which can be used for the heating of homes. It can incorporate the extra heat exchanger so it can enable the hot gases the ability to transfer some energy to preheat water inside of your boiler system. This type of boiler is becoming quite popular among many homeowners for the purpose of providing heat to their homes.

It has a large tank for storage which provides the hot water. There are pipes that can serve a useful purpose, as one pipe will be able to carry gas to the burners while the other pipes will be used for a central heating system. The burning gas produces condensed water vapour that is carried by this plastic pipe.

Some of the domestic ones are now becoming popular as they are able to save a good amount of energy. The boiler has a high efficiency by using the heat which would otherwise become wasted. The boiler can also increase transferred heat to the boiler as well.

These types of boilers were designed from the older and more traditional water heaters. With the conventional ones the substantial amount of the heat ...
... was always lost from the products of its combustions and as a result the heat was then wasted. But with the condensing boiler it consists of the extra heat exchanger.

With that, the hot gases shall give up a more energy so to preheat water which is in the boiler system. And the water vapour that is produced from the combustion process will condense right back to liquid forms and then will release some latent heat.

With the domestic ones the fuel is natural gas, but with the condensing ones they can be operated with oil or even LPG. These boilers are very well suited for the larger areas and buildings that have extensive heating systems.

In some cases the condensing boilers can produce water vapour right around the flue terminal and so it is important to be sure to site the flue terminal properly so this way the plume will not ever discharge over the neighbouring properties.

Some of the benefits of this type of boiler are that it is known to be much more productive, as you can have more heat that is extracted and that is more efficient. It can also generate less pollution compared to any other kinds of burners. One other good benefit is that they are cost effective too, making them a great investment for any homeowner.
